The Jharkhand High Court lifted its stay on the probe into a protester’s death outside Bokaro Steel Plant. The investigation of FIR 64/2025 can now proceed. The court is also examining the related case filed by plant officials. A final hearing is scheduled for September 18.

Prime Minister Modi will visit Mizoram, Manipur, Assam, West Bengal, and Bihar from September 13-15, 2025. He will launch projects worth over ₹71,850 crore focusing on infrastructure, connectivity, cultural integration, and farmer welfare. Key initiatives include new rail lines, road projects, and various developments in education, energy, and agriculture.

Charlie Kirk, founder of Turning Point USA, was fatally shot in Utah during a political event on September 10, 2025. The shooter, using a bolt-action rifle, remains unidentified. Kirk’s death sparked political outrage and has led to increased security and renewed debates on political violence.

Two terrorists were killed in an ongoing encounter in Kulgam, South Kashmir. A joint security team initiated a search operation based on intelligence, leading to a gunfight. One Army JCO was injured and is stable. The operation continues, with the terrorists’ identities unconfirmed.

A Pakistani national, Siraaj Khan, was apprehended by BSF troops on September 7, 2025, after crossing the IB in Jammu. He advanced aggressively towards the border fence despite warnings. Pakistani currency was found, and he was handed over to police. A protest will be lodged with Pakistan Rangers.
